Exterior storm windows

Storm windows are flat, exterior panels that you install during the winter over your regular windows. They fit into the same frame as your existing windows, and offer another layer of protection against drafts and heat loss. Storm windows don’t open or close. In this way, they are less functional than other types of windows.

Mar 22, 2023 · A storm window is a safety panel that is installed on the interior or exterior of the window pane. They are installed either within or outside the primary windows and serve as an additional layer of protection to the window. Storm windows are mostly made of glass. However, solid plastic can also be used alternatively. 1) To protect the prime window against the weather 2) To improve the energy performance of the prime window. It’s this second purpose where interior storm windows really shine. They can be very effective at improving the efficiency of old windows without compromising the exterior aesthetics. Reflect radiant heat 35% better than clear glass storm windows; Act as an air sealing measure and can reduce overall home air leakage by 10% or more; Low-e exterior or interior storm windows can save you 10%–30% on heating and cooling costs, depending on the type of window already installed in the home. Remove loose debris on window frames by wiping with a soft cloth. Clean window panes with a household glass cleaner and dry thoroughly to prevent streaking. Remove window screens and wash with warm, soapy water, or leave screens in place and wipe with a damp cloth to remove dust and dirt.
